There
are two ways to set the dimensions of character in animations, which
were made by Macromedia ® Flash ™ or Corel ® R.A.V.E.
™ programs. We need to know the details of font in order to choice
the better way.
Usually,
the name of the font is "Fontname_Style_Pixel",
for example FixedPix_Bold_7. The represented number does not give enough
information about the particular type.
These
kinds of pixelfont are shown on the basis of their dimensions, that was
set in Flash ™!. Usually the compared dimensions are 8, 10, 12
points. These numbers show the dimensions, which were set in Flash ™.
If the font is made for 8 points Flash ™ dimension, then the mentioned
FixedPix_Bold_7 will be actually 7 points. When we make fonts, keep it
before our eyes,
that the fonts are designed for 8 points between 5 and 8 points, for
10 points between 9 and 10, for 12 points between 11 and 12 points. We
can get known about this feature from only the font-foundry. Usually
this data is not public when we download free pixelfonts. It's practical
to choose the pixelfonts on the basis of dimension in its name. We can
enlarge the fonts only event multiple (2x, 4x, 6x…) without losing quality,
and readability. So we will get the 14 points real size at a 7 points
(it is set Flash 8 points) charatcer (2x multiple), if we set 16 points.

There
is an other and easier way to present pixelfont perfectly in Flash
™. In this case the number in fontname shows the suggested
size. This will result a more precision and sharper presentation.
It is
practical
to enlarge by whole number miltiple, but You can use the font enlarged
by odd number. This way is much easier to set dimension. The developers
can use twice as much sizes, without losing quality. The fonts of
PixelFonts Library ™ were made this way.
